1.2 What Are the Different Modes Available in Free Online Tetris?
Free online Tetris often includes modes like Marathon, where you play to reach a high level; Sprint, where you aim to clear a set number of lines as fast as possible; and Ultra, where you score as many points as possible within a time limit.
Marathon Mode: In Marathon mode, the primary goal is to reach the highest level possible. Players start at level one and progress through increasingly difficult levels as they clear lines. The speed at which the Tetriminos fall increases with each level, demanding quicker reflexes and strategic thinking. This mode tests endurance and skill, as players must maintain focus and efficiency over an extended period.
Sprint Mode: Sprint mode is all about speed. The objective is to clear a predetermined number of lines, typically 40 lines, in the shortest amount of time. This mode requires rapid decision-making and efficient line clearing techniques. Players often employ strategies such as T-spins and perfect clears to maximize their speed and achieve the best possible time.
Ultra Mode: Ultra mode challenges players to score as many points as possible within a specified time limit, usually three minutes. This mode demands a combination of speed and strategic play. Players must quickly clear lines while also aiming for bonus points through complex maneuvers like Tetrises (clearing four lines at once) and T-spins. Ultra mode is a high-pressure, fast-paced challenge that tests a player’s ability to perform under pressure.

6.1 What is “Stacking” in Tetris?
Stacking in Tetris refers to the strategic placement of blocks to create a solid foundation and leave opportunities for clearing multiple lines at once. Good stacking minimizes gaps and allows for efficient line clearing.
- Creating a Solid Foundation: The primary goal of stacking is to create a solid foundation of Tetriminos that minimizes gaps and provides stability. This involves carefully placing each block to create a smooth and even surface. A solid foundation makes it easier to clear lines and prevents the stack from becoming unstable.
- Leaving Opportunities for Line Clearing: Effective stacking involves leaving strategic gaps in the foundation that can be filled with specific Tetriminos to clear multiple lines at once. For example, leaving a one-block-wide well on one side of the playing field allows you to clear four lines simultaneously with a long I-shaped Tetrimino.
- Minimizing Gaps: Gaps in the stack can be difficult to fill and can lead to an unstable playing field. Good stacking minimizes gaps by carefully considering the shape and orientation of each Tetrimino before placing it. This involves anticipating future block placements and planning accordingly.
- Efficient Line Clearing: The ultimate goal of stacking is to create opportunities for efficient line clearing. By strategically placing the Tetriminos, you can set up situations where a single block can clear multiple lines at once, maximizing your score and minimizing the risk of the stack reaching the top of the playing field.

9. What is the History of Game Tetris?
Tetris was created by Alexey Pajitnov in 1984 while working at the Dorodnitsyn Computing Centre of the Soviet Academy of Sciences in Moscow. It quickly gained popularity worldwide and has since become one of the most iconic video games of all time.
- Creation by Alexey Pajitnov: Tetris was created by Alexey Pajitnov, a Soviet software engineer, in 1984. Pajitnov was working at the Dorodnitsyn Computing Centre of the Soviet Academy of Sciences in Moscow when he developed the game as a side project.
- Inspiration from Pentominoes: Pajitnov drew inspiration for Tetris from a puzzle game called Pentominoes, which involves arranging 12 different shapes, each made up of five squares, to fit into a rectangular box. Pajitnov simplified the game by using shapes made up of four squares, which he called Tetriminos.
- Worldwide Popularity: Tetris quickly gained popularity worldwide after its release. The game was initially distributed on floppy disks and shared among computer enthusiasts. It gained wider recognition when it was licensed by Nintendo for the Game Boy in 1989.
- Iconic Video Game: Tetris has become one of the most iconic video games of all time, with millions of copies sold worldwide. The game has been released on numerous platforms, including consoles, computers, mobile devices, and even arcade machines. Tetris is known for its simple yet addictive gameplay, which has made it a favorite of players of all ages.
